"This is the best car I have ever owned"

What things have gone wrong with the car?

The tie rod bushings on both sides have went out twice, the rotors had to be replaced, brakes and brake lines have been replaced, and headlight were rewired.

General comments?

The car is very quick. I love the car to death it is absolutely amazing. The car is extremely comfortable and reliable. With my lead foot the car has held up and probably will hold up to me. The wiring is very easy to do and I had the headlights rewired in less than 1 hour.
